Understanding Small Business Cybersecurity

Cybersecurity means protecting your computers, networks, and sensitive information from unauthorized individuals. Many small businesses still rely on outdated methods, but today’s cybercriminals use advanced techniques. It's time to upgrade your defenses with modern tools and strategies.

Here are some key cybersecurity resources and terms to know:

  • Firewalls: Block unwanted access to your network

  • Antivirus Software: Detects and removes harmful programs

  • Mobile Device Security: Protects phones and tablets used for work

  • Virtual Private Network (VPN): Creates a secure, private connection, especially important for remote workers using public Wi-Fi networks

  • Wireless Access Point Security: Keeps your Wi-Fi protected from outsiders

Common Cybersecurity Threats Facing Small Businesses

Cybercriminals use many strategies to target businesses. Here are some of the most common threats:

  • Phishing: Fake emails trick you into giving away passwords or clicking dangerous links

  • Smishing: Fraudulent SMS messages attempt to steal company or personal data

  • Ransomware: Malware locks your files and demands payment to unlock them

  • Data Theft: Hackers steal sensitive information from unsecured devices

  • Public Wi-Fi Risks: Unprotected Wi-Fi networks, like those at coffee shops, are easy targets for cyberattacks

Affordable and Effective Cybersecurity Solutions

The good news is that protecting your business doesn’t have to break the bank. Here are some tips for small business cybersecurity:

  • Antivirus Software and Firewalls: Your first line of defense

  • VPN (Virtual Private Network): Protects remote workers and sensitive information

  •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A): Adds a second layer of security to login processes

  • Mobile Device Management (MDM): Helps you control and secure work smartphones and tablets

  • Cloud Backups and Data Encryption: Safeguard your business information and allow for quick recovery after an incident

  • Password Protect All Systems: Require strong passwords for every account and device

  • Secure Your Access Point or Router: Update passwords and firmware regularly and disable remote management

Building a Strong Cybersecurity Culture

Technology alone is not enough. Building a cybersecurity culture within your business is essential.

🧠 Employee Training & Awareness

Your team is your first defense against cyber threats. Teach employees to:

  • Identify phishing and smishing attempts.

  • Use strong passwords and password-protect sensitive systems.

  • Avoid sharing sensitive information over an unsecured channel.

  • Create a separate user account for each employee to minimize risks.

  • Hold regular cybersecurity training sessions and phishing tests to keep everyone sharp.

🔁 Regular Software Updates

Always update:

  • Operating systems (Windows, macOS)

  • Antivirus and firewall software

  • Business applications

Outdated software is a major vulnerability for cyberattacks.

🔐 Role-Based Access Control (RBAC)

Not every employee needs access to all your systems. With RBAC:

  • Limit access to sensitive customer information based on job roles.

  • Protect financial and HR data from unauthorized individuals.

  • Only grant access to what an employee truly needs.

🚨 Incident Response Plan

Create a clear plan that explains:

  • How to report suspicious activity

  • What to do if ransomware strikes

  • How to maintain business operations during a cyberattack

    Review and practice this plan regularly with your team.

Key Cybersecurity Tools and Services for Small Businesses

Modern IT support for small businesses includes services such as:

  • Endpoint Detection & Response (EDR): Monitors devices for threats

  • Managed Detection & Response (MDR): 24/7 threat monitoring by cybersecurity experts

  • Cloud Firewalls: Safeguard online applications and data storage

  • Secure Email Gateways: Block dangerous emails before they reach your inbox
